Hearings on Evidences on Case of Maltese Bank and Azerbaijan Government Due in June

Azerbaijan, Baku /corr Trend S.Babayeva / The Azerbaijani Ministry of Communications and Information Technologies reported that in June the Rotterdam Court will hold hearings on evidences by witnesses on the case between the Azerbaijan government and the Maltese FIMbank (First International Merchant Bank).

During the previous hearings the court took evidences by ex-president of FIMbank, residing in Canada. At the same time, a deputy head of the bank's department was also to give a testimony, while it was postponed due to objective reasons. The second witness from the bank and one witness from the Azerbaijani side will give testimony at the hearings scheduled for 4 June.

In July 2004, the Maltese FIMbank raised a claim against the Azerbaijani Government regarding the non-payment of credit issued under the guarantee of the Communications Ministry and AKB Pochtbank to non-existent enterprises of the Ministry, Aztell $3,035,000 and Baktell $1,560,000.
